Use this task to sell a single product in different pack sizes, keeping available inventory levels synchronized appropriately, storing the "main" inventory level in a product tag (e.g. "inventory:50").
New orders for a pack-sized variant will result in the product's inventory tag being updated, and all pack-sized variants having their available inventory levels re-synced. And, manually updating a product's inventory tag will automatically re-sync variant available inventory levels as well.
The pack size for each variant can be determined by a numeric product option (e.g. "Pack size"), or by metafield.
This task will skip any products that do not have an inventory tag, and will skip any variants ordered that have no pack size information.
